Output 18c17751878a8c8d8e8e8b7fe1ec1bafa3327a98db915eec2deb1af64cb6a96d:1

value
13495609
script pubkey
OP_0 OP_PUSHBYTES_20 8dba59759800d14fab9ee248d2b42bb2a1e30813
address
bc1q3ka9javcqrg5l2u7ufyd9dptk2s7xzqn9c34dr
transaction
18c17751878a8c8d8e8e8b7fe1ec1bafa3327a98db915eec2deb1af64cb6a96d
spent
true